Beware of Phishing PMs
Some users received a PM (personal message) from a (now banned) member called "Marmites" like this:
hey,
we’ve been keeping an eye on your progress, looking good!
the reason for this private message is because we are currently looking for a selected few bodyspace members to be on the main page of the bodyspace banner.
it’s going to be new and exciting and what a better way to kick it off with new faces.
here’s a quick sign up form http://ad.bodybuilding.com
all the best!
DON’T CLICK ON THE LINK!
This is what is known as a phishing scam. If you did get one of these PMs, you would have (hopefully) noticed that the link text “http://ad.bodybuilding.com” didn’t match the actual link URL, which was pointing to an outside site (ending with “.tk”). Moral of the story, before you click a link, always glance at the status bar to make sure the link you are about to click is actually going to where you think it is. ![]()
If you did click this link, please CHANGE your PASSWORD immediately!
